Output fc981d7ca924faeb5206bc29694ce50226955cf4c972bf2e22ac72a2ff27641c:7

value
17323262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30710a2529bf0fa80426c256ce6fd4bb3cb9c12e OP_EQUAL
address
3679mt9tKnftp82DKt7egXrCHSeMd2vjjm
transaction
fc981d7ca924faeb5206bc29694ce50226955cf4c972bf2e22ac72a2ff27641c
spent
true